Type
ORACLE
Validation date
2024-11-21 05:48: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0177,
    "usd": 0.01868
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001DB78A3D45136BBF0C9ADFF5BED828608791A37F8ADFA75622AB942324A1627AF

Previous signature

544B707511EFF288B010CA8A9FBC4484D21C7BD9958BA39FB4663A88B5626623353A84BA487109782D4377688E782BBB80FB8724DB8954437BE908AADE20DF04

Origin signature

3045022100ADAC91CDE68B1761568ED352E11470EB77B1BD8D1C1F29591E07597C809327290220030348122DE25FE7A03391F67918523F4B4755BD3536A18C1C7131FAC5D9B886

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

00204978D89DAE48B473BC60ABA6B05297AABF3D788F34432C8824DE47AC0511FE

Coordinator signature

4CE3F6A5176B86DA4D73ABBB24CA2BA85CF45868E336A46AF0174688474D707A9F2AC37A8AFED70B367ACF827D55106C970AE0ACE17470486B72D2592E5D0103

Validator #1 public key

000109F3F0A3EA1C4E40F676D27DF717E0A0C76D4A9EC89A8CAD79DFD414C78C1CD2

Validator #1 signature

F6158581DAFBC8C3F3FBB2566CDE9448BB459BCAC9C4353EB40BBC20E45862022AC8BAA5C937148AACCF1636FD830CAE46F9CB575FC83C4559FFAF737DE4840D

Validator #2 public key

0001495101672E3A9A57CD61520FB6F0E381E111EFFF0C2EAD677336BABB33C45C6A

Validator #2 signature

406DD6CE793E4ABD89FFE7352C3BF9D2302ED8D7135BCF92C56F92B8F9F359BE5B480AAAF5F393B374D88E9EF592426A1F0DE1845F59A7448B5B4E544691E004